Higher overall performance liquid chromatography (HPLC) emerged as a powerful analytical Instrument through the seventies as development was created in bonding sturdy phases to silica [one]. The very first report of the HPLC technique for nicotine and cotinine in smokers’ urine was by Watson in 1977 [2]. He carried out an extraction of basified urine and utilized a normal-section isocratic method with UV detection. In contrast with existing GC solutions, this method was quicker with each nicotine and cotinine eluting from the column in a lot less than five minutes. Afterwards, a quick strategy using XAD-two resin for sample preparation followed by regular-period HPLC and UV detection for last resolve was described and claimed detection limits for nicotine and cotinine of 2 ng/mL [three].
